Here are a few things I've stumbled into as I continue to explore this cool product. Everything here is IMHO, but would be great to see addressed in the next patch.

o Sheets should not be scrollable if their entire content is visible. Further, a sheet should not be scrollable well past the end of its content; it should stop at the ornamental end cap graphic as a visual cue that the sheet is at its end.

o Links that open new sheets to images, or other text sheets, display the new sheet on top of all others the first time only. If the newly opened sheet is covered (not closed) by another sheet, clicking the link again does not raise the new sheet to the topmost layer; the GM must find it manually.

Example: Open Story, click link 'cathedral - second floor', click link 'map of the upper floor, click in the story sheet to bring it on top of the map, click link 'map of the upper floor'. The map remains below the story sheet.

o Sheets that are resized with the Ctrl key, do not remember their new size once closed and reopened. Sheets should have a radial menu option to be restored to their default size, and in all other cases remember the GM's sizing choice.

o When dragging out the size of a grid for an image map, holding down the Shift key should cause the top-left of the grid to align with the top-left of the image regardless of where I have clicked to declare the grid sizing. This would obviate the need to precisely position a grid for maps that are already grid aligned (like Dundjinni maps). I can clarify if need be.

o Image sheets need an immediate means of returning to 100% zoom. Perhaps clicking on the tiny magnifying glass icon in the upper-right could do this.

o When panning an image sheet, the user is presented with a Hand Cursor, which infers a "push/pull" metaphor for navigation. Unfortunately, the user must perform the exact opposite action of that which is implied. I suggest reversing the Hand Cursor behavior (dragging downward should slide unviewed upper image area into view), or altering the Cursor to become a Four-Way Arrow Cursor.

o After having dragged a "personality" into the Combat Tracker sheet, a link should be generated on the combat sheet immediately to the left of the name field that links right back to the corresponding Personality sheet. This would enable the GM to quickly view details on a specific combat entity without having to track down each specific personality sheet. Because of other discussion threads, this may already be in the works, dunno.

o The "desktop" needs a shortcut means of closing all presently open sheets, as a means of "clearing the field" and allowing the GM/PC to re-open only what is desired/needed.
